I cannot play a DVD when using two screens
❑
When you use two screens at the same time (LCD and TV / LCD and CRT), the following errors will occur:
❑
You will see a Hardware Overlay error message if you attempt to launch Click to DVD.
❑
You cannot play a DVD with Windows Media Player version 8 or 9.
❑
You cannot play a DVD with Real One Player. This is because your computer uses the "video overlay"
when two screens are in use. The software applications above do not support this feature, which is
why the problems occur.
❑
You will not have a problem in the following situations:
❑
When you use a CRT or an LCD display on its own.
❑
When you play MPEG files which are recorded on the hard drive with Windows Media Player 9 or
RealOne Player.
The reading speed of CD/DVD-RWs is very slow
Generally, the reading speed of a CD-RW is slower than that of a -ROM or -R. The reading speed can also
vary depending on the type of format.
Why does my CD-RW drive not record at the highest speed?
You must use 16x CD-R or 8x CD-RW media or higher to achieve optimum performance.
If you want to use other media and are having difficulty formatting non-8x CD-RW discs, change the writing
speed from 8x to a lower setting.
